13 Aug 2026

Universitätsklinikum Halle (Saale) has awarded a €1.23 million contract to Brainlab Sales GmbH for a digital, mobile robotic imaging and navigation system for the Department of Neurosurgery. The system will support intraoperative imaging, precise navigation, and robot-assisted neurosurgical procedures including tumour surgery and spinal interventions. 12 Aug 2026

Stadtwerke Augsburg Holding GmbH has awarded a three-lot framework agreement for gas and water construction works valued at up to €23.2 million. The contracts, covering West, Northeast, and South regions of Augsburg, have been awarded to GW-TEC GmbH & Co. KG, Ludwig Pfeiffer Hoch- und Tiefbau GmbH & Co. KG, and LEONHARD WEISS GmbH & Co. KG. Procurement Analysis Procedure: An open procedure under the German Sector Regulations (SektVO) was used, which applies to procurement in the water, energy, transport, and postal services sectors. Competition: Three bids were received for each lot, with all three winners being medium-sized German companies. Evaluation criteria: Quality criteria (Project Manager: 15 points, Deputy Project Manager: 5 points) and Price (80 points). The quality criteria focus on the experience and qualifications of project managers. Lot limitation: Each bidder could only win one lot. This ensured that three different companies were awarded the contracts, spreading the work across the region. Strategic procurement: Climate change mitigation is included as a strategic objective. SME participation: All three winners are medium-sized enterprises, demonstrating SME accessibility. Geographic distribution: The three lots cover West, Northeast, and South regions of Augsburg. Additional Procurement Facts The contract is not covered by the WTO Government Procurement Agreement (GPA). No EU funds were used for this procurement. The procurement was not accelerated. No dynamic purchasing system was used. Framework agreements without reopening of competition were used. Each lot has a maximum value cap—once reached, the contract ends automatically. Each lot has a minimum guaranteed value. All bids were submitted electronically. No subcontracting was declared by any winner. Disputes or review requests fall to the Vergabekammer Südbayern. 11 Aug 2026

The City of Dresden has awarded a €14.6 million contract to LEONHARD WEISS GmbH & Co. KG for the renovation and corrosion protection of the historic Loschwitz Bridge (Blaues Wunder). The four-year project covers extensive scaffolding, steelwork, and anti-corrosion coating works on the Blasewitz half of the iconic Elbe bridge. Introduction The Loschwitz Bridge, known locally as the "Blaues Wunder" (Blue Wonder), is one of Dresden's most iconic landmarks. This historic steel bridge spanning the Elbe River has been a symbol of the city since its completion in 1893. Over 130 years of service have taken their toll, and the bridge now requires extensive renovation and corrosion protection work. The City of Dresden's Roads and Civil Engineering Office has awarded a €14.6 million contract to LEONHARD WEISS GmbH & Co. KG for the renovation and corrosion protection of the Blasewitz half of the bridge. The four-year project covers scaffolding, steelwork, and anti-corrosion coating works across the historic structure. Procurement Analysis Procedure: An open procedure under VOB/A (German Construction Contract Procedures) was used. Competition: Six bids were received, representing a competitive field for a specialist bridge renovation project. All bidders were from Germany. Evaluation criteria: Technical value (30%) and Price (70%). The price weighting reflects the importance of cost efficiency for the public budget. Value for money: The winning bid (€14.64 million) was significantly below the estimated value (€16.58 million), a saving of approximately 12%. No subcontracting: LEONHARD WEISS will deliver the project without subcontracting. Duration: Approximately 4.5 years, reflecting the complexity and scale of the works. SME participation: Three of six bids came from SMEs, indicating that the procurement was accessible to smaller firms.
